Floki's Valhalla Partners with OG Esports as Official Jersey Sleeve Sponsor

Table of Contents

Floki’s Valhalla, a play-to-earn blockchain game, announced a groundbreaking partnership with OG Esports. This collaboration will see Valhalla as the official jersey sleeve sponsor for OG Esports.

Further, the Valhalla game will be showcased at OG Esports events and fans will be able to access exclusive content.

 

The move reportedly aims to enhance the gaming experience for fans while promoting crypto adoption.

“Together with OG Esports, we’re ready to redefine the battlegrounds of the web3 and GameFi space — where strategy meets immersion, and every move shapes an epic world of endless possibilities,” said Mr. Brown Whale, Valhalla lead and core advisor.

Founded in 2015 by Johan ‘n0tail’ Sundstein, OG Esports has emerged as one of the most celebrated brands in the esports world. The organization is renowned for its championship-winning teams, including its Dota 2 squad, which triumphed at The International in 2018 and 2019. 

 

OG Esports also boasts teams in Counter-Strike 2 and Rocket League, solidifying its reputation as a powerhouse in competitive gaming.

 

In contrast, Valhalla offers a vibrant, MMORPG open world inspired by Norse mythology, where players interact with a diverse range of creatures known as Veras. This game reportedly allows for a rich gaming experience, combining strategic gameplay with an immersive virtual world. 

Expanding Horizons

This collaboration comes in the wake of another major partnership for Floki, Valhalla’s parent company. Recently, Floki secured an official partnership with Nottingham Forest Football Club for the Premier League 2024/2025 season. 

 

This deal aims to enhance Floki’s visibility, with branding displayed during home matches and across digital platforms. The Premier League's massive global audience, reaching over 2.7 billion viewers per matchday, provides a significant exposure boost for both Floki and Valhalla.

 

Additionally, Floki recently launched its trading bot on the mainnet of Ethereum, BNB, and Base. This tool reportedly offers a seamless trading experience directly from Telegram, supporting multiple languages and integrating with decentralized exchange aggregators to ensure competitive prices.
